Назад | Перейти на главную страницу

Как отправить копию: с помощью Bmail.exe

Мы используем bmail.exe для большой автоматизированной работы, и иногда мы хотели бы использовать cc :, но приложение не предоставляет входной параметр для него.

Однако он позволяет вам установить тело и объект, так что есть ли способ вставить cc: в объект или тело, чтобы оно появилось?

Bmail имеет следующие параметры -

C:\>bmail /?

Command Line SMTP Emailer V1.07
Copyright(C) 2002-2004 Craig.Peacock@beyondlogic.org
Usage: bmail [options]
        -s    SMTP Server Name
        -p    SMTP Port Number (optional, defaults to 25)
        -t    To: Address
        -f    From: Address
        -b    Text Body of Message (optional)
        -h    Generate Headers
        -a    Subject (optional)
        -m    Filename (optional) Use file as Body of Message
            -c    Prefix above file with CR/LF to separate body from header
            -d    Debug (Show all mail server communications)

Мне интересно, не использую ли я -c можно ли добавить в cc: в шапку через тело? И как это сделать? Я бы предположил, что с помощью этого метода также можно было бы использовать bcc :.

Кто-нибудь когда-нибудь делал это? Спасибо

Тема электронного письма - это особая часть тела письма, а поля «Копия» и «Скрытая копия» являются частью заголовка. Вы не можете имитировать, что часть тела должна стать частью заголовка, поскольку, если бы это было возможно, вы могли бы случайно отправить электронные письма на адреса электронной почты, которые вы только что обсуждали как часть электронного письма.
Увидеть RFC для получения дополнительной информации.

Лучшим вариантом, вероятно, будет поиск замены инструмента на тот, который поддерживает CC или BCC, или, поскольку это SO, сайт для разработчиков, довольно легко написать простое приложение командной строки для отправки простых электронных писем. если вам не нужно беспокоиться о прикрепленных файлах, MIME и т. д.

Быстрый взгляд на Google привел меня к Блат, о котором я помню, как читал в другой раз. Blat - это утилита командной строки Win32, которая отправляет электронную почту с помощью SMTP или отправляет в usenet с помощью NNTP.. На странице синтаксиса на этом веб-сайте упоминаются флаги как для CC, так и для BCC.